Is there evidence that COVID-19 has slowed in Europe due to herd immunity? No. The most likely explanation remains the simplest. Movement restrictions have slowed the virus, but as they are lifted, many remain at risk. A thread on the evidence. 1/6https://www.thelancet.com/journals/lancet/article/PIIS0140-6736(20)31357-X/fulltext …
